aboutsummaryrefslogtreecommitdiffstats
path: root/src/lib/pubkey/ec_group
diff options
context:
space:
mode:
authorJack Lloyd <[email protected]>2016-03-05 13:01:23 -0500
committerJack Lloyd <[email protected]>2016-03-05 13:01:23 -0500
commitc3540ae668a523c0155677c4ee4c9099910110bc (patch)
treebe4b952913d2684d012f115acdc81d26b36b2873 /src/lib/pubkey/ec_group
parentfbdc39de29a0efbcd13ad169c844189168d2110d (diff)
Remove explicit from DL_Group, EC_Group constructors taking std::string
I think we maybe want these to be converting constructors, and adding explicit here breaks code like ECDSA_PrivateKey(rng, "secp256r1") which seems like a reasonable thing to support IMO
Diffstat (limited to 'src/lib/pubkey/ec_group')
-rw-r--r--src/lib/pubkey/ec_group/ec_group.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/lib/pubkey/ec_group/ec_group.h b/src/lib/pubkey/ec_group/ec_group.h
index 3f2a389a5..a03b97a68 100644
--- a/src/lib/pubkey/ec_group/ec_group.h
+++ b/src/lib/pubkey/ec_group/ec_group.h
@@ -67,7 +67,7 @@ class BOTAN_DLL EC_Group
* from an OID name (eg "secp256r1", or "1.2.840.10045.3.1.7")
* @param pem_or_oid PEM-encoded data, or an OID
*/
- explicit EC_Group(const std::string& pem_or_oid = "");
+ EC_Group(const std::string& pem_or_oid = "");
/**
* Create the DER encoding of this domain